What You’ll Need
Batch of chilled sugar cookie dough (homemade or store-bought)
Flour
Rolling pin
Wax paper
Baking sheet
Cooling rack
Kitchen knife
White cookie icing
Candy necklaces or other small candies
Colored sugar (optional)
Food decorator pens (optional)
Helpful Tip
 If the store-bought brand of dough you use is too soft to hold the cookie shapes during baking, you can knead in a little extra flour to stiffen it before rolling it out.
How To Make It
  • Print the template and cut it out. Roll out the dough on a floured surface to 1/4-inch thickness, then use the template and a knife to cut out mermaid tail cookies. Bake the cookies according to the recipe directions and let them cool.
  • Working with one cookie at a time, spread cookie icing on the tail fin. Then spread more icing on a 2-inch section of the tail just above the fin and gently press candies into it, arranging them close together to resemble scales. Continue frosting and decorating the rest of the tail a section at a time until you reach the top. Or, you can simply sprinkle colored sugar on the icing in place of the candy.
  • Set the cookies aside until the icing hardens. Then use food decorator pens to embellish the tail fins with colorful lines, if you like.
